Property Description

Luxury Historic Hotel
Located on the Freedom Trail near Boston Common, the Boston Omni Parker House Hotel offers a blend of luxury and history.

Gastronomic Delights
Indulge in local specialties at Parker’s Restaurant, from the famous Boston cream pie to the Parker House Roll. Sip on specialty cocktails at The Last Hurrah while enjoying a selection of fine whiskey.

Family-Friendly Amenities
The hotel caters to families with a 24-hour fitness center, local jogging trail maps, and a backpack of games for children.

Property Policies

  • Pets

    Pets are allowed on request. Charges may be applicable.

  • Children and extra bed policy

    Children of any age are allowed.
    Children up to and including 2 years old stay for free when using an available cot.
    Children up to and including 17 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
    People no matter the age stay for free when using an available extra bed.
    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management.

  • Internet

    WiFi is available in the hotel rooms and is free of charge.

  • Groups

    When booking more than 9 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.

  • Parking

    Private parking is possible on site (reservation is not needed) and costs USD 65 per day.

Omni Room 303
Pros:

Arriving at the Omni without a reservation, my stay began before I even left my car. The doorman was very informative, welcoming and was genuinely happy to give me tips and tricks to the city.

Once inside, I was amazed with the atmosphere. Even late at night, there was a calm hustle-and-bustle and the building is beautiful.

The young man at check-in managed to get me into one of my dream rooms (303), gave me a couple water bottles, a card for a complimentary drink and a printout of the... history.

The room is nestled in the corner and arranged and decorated very comfortably. The bathroom was simple, yet stylish.

I experienced thee burts of light from the area near the window that overlooks some sort of outside corridor. They were unexplained but not bothersome. Often, there was an extremely faint sound, similar to a noise machine, that was barely noticeable, got slightly louder (still barely noticeable) and then stopped.

During the night, there was a small group of overly excited guests in the hallway. I assume they used the stairs, although I never heard them exit or enter a different room. Besides that, the room was very quiet and I enjoyed my stay.

The checkout process is very simple and they held my luggage while I explored the city. It is worth taking the time to photograph the lobby and other public areas. I got some great shots.

My stay at the Omni was perfect and I would 100% recommend!
